Kop: A Great Opportunity To Make History

LCFC Women goalkeeper Lize Kip is targeting a spot in the semi-finals as the Foxes meet Liverpool this Saturday afternoon in the Adobe Women’s FA Cup.

This weekend sees Leicester travel to Liverpool where the two sides will meet in the the FA Cup at Prenton Park.

Keen to keep the cup run going, Kop previewed the fixture during Thursday’s press conference at Belvoir Drive and believes there are qualities from the recent Chelsea defeat that the Foxes should learn from.

“We’re all very excited to play the game this Saturday against Liverpool,” the ‘keeper explained. “It’s a great chance for us to get into the semi-final so we’re excited, especially after the Chelsea game.

“We had a good first half last weekend, and we need to keep building on that, and bring that confidence into the Liverpool game.

“It’s always nice to play games, that’s why I came here in the summer; to build myself, but also the team. So, for me to be playing is very exciting and I’m enjoying the time on the pitch.”

Picking up an early injury during her time with the Club, the Dutch shot-stopper is delighted to have her chance in the team, but also commends the ability of Janina Leitzig, saying that the two of them share a good connection and do well to push each other on.

“I had an injury at the start of the season, so to begin with, it was about getting back fit and building confidence on the pitch,” Kop continued. “I needed to prove I could be playing the games.

“I got the opportunities in the Continental Tyres League Cup, so it was nice to use those games to show my qualities and I appreciated the chance to play.

“The truth is we have two really good goalkeepers so it’s nice that we can get the best out of each other, where I can learn from Jani (Janina Leitzig) and she can learn from me, and it’s nice to be in an environment like this.

“You always play in the same position so you want to play, but this season has been different where we can both play games, and we can learn from each other. We understand our position well and it’s nice that we can talk and have that strong union.”

A win on Saturday afternoon in Tranmere would see City reach the semi-final of the competition for the first time in their history.

Manager Willie Kirk has experienced a Wembley final during his time with Everton and Kop explained how he has been sharing his thoughts during recent training sessions and how the whole team aims for passage into the next round.

“It’s history for the Club, so it’s a great opportunity for us to reach the next round,” the 25-year-old voiced. “We’re going to go for it and I’m very excited.

“The Manager has spoken about his experience of being there before and we all want to get to the final. It’s a great opportunity and we all want to play in it so that’s a good motivation.

“As sports professionals, we want to win every game and this is just another one of those cases, but of course it is special should we make history by making it into the semi-final.”

Liverpool will be no easy task, however, as they have seen three victories on the bounce, which included a 2-0 win over London City Lionesses in the previous round.

Kop spoke once again about Chelsea and how the Foxes must use promising parts of this game to challenge the Reds this weekend.

The No.23 added: “We played a good first half against Chelsea, and I think we need to bring that same performance and confidence against Liverpool and just focus on our own game.

“We can’t be distracted about the game they are trying to play because we are a good team and that’s the most important part, to help us get a good result.”
